The first mod you should do is replace all the uncoated aluminum on the engine. Especially the rocker box covers. These will corrode and get cloudy at the first drop of rain. Unless you never plan to ride in the rain, then they look pretty cool :P I've personally had the cruise control and heated griped installed on mine, love both upgrades. If you want a sissy bar, don't get a harley branded one, cheap cheap cheap chinese steel and bolts. Mine wasn't even painted all the way through so it was rusted decently. The passenger seat from harley isn't super great either, it's functional but rock hard.

I finally received my auxiliary lamps back from the powder coater. These are 5" lamps as compared to the 4" standard lamps. An old friend of mine bought them at Pep Boys in 1955 for $5. each. He gave them to me in 1969, and I have kept them in the original boxes ever since. I was saving them for a special project. I bought my Slim a few months ago and decided that this was the special project I had been waiting for. I also blacked out the headlight ring. I purchased the auxiliary lamp kit, #68000026, from Intermountain HD in Salt Lake City, Utah. Internet purchase for $169.95. All other dealers want $219.99.
I switched out my front fender for a Fatboy fender. Direct bolt on.
Added Kuryakin Slip ons in place of stock mufflers.
The stock seat was a killer to ride, so it was switched for a LePera.
Hi intensity LED lights were switched out at the rear. Talk about BRIGHT!!!
Just ordered a leather swingarm saddlebag from Leatherworks. Ordered the XL model. 5" wide instead of the 3 1/2" wide ones offered by all other companies.
